USS Idaho
Five ships of the
United States Navy
have been named
USS
Idaho
in honor of
the 43rd state
.
USS
Idaho
(1864)
was a wooden steam
sloop
later converted to a full-rigged sailing ship
USS
Idaho
(BB-24)
, a
Mississippi
-class
battleship
, was launched on 9 December 1905 and was sold to Greece on 30 July 1914
USS
Idaho
(SP-545)
was a motor boat acquired by the US Navy in June 1917 and returned to her owner 30 November 1918
USS
Idaho
(BB-42)
was a
New Mexico
-class
battleship
launched on 30 June 1917, saw action in World War II, and was sold for scrap 24 November 1947
USS
Idaho
(SSN-799)
is a
Virginia
-class submarine currently authorized for construction
